If you've never experienced the Viking-centric adventure series The Banner Saga, you've been missing out. Luckily, you don't have to miss out much longer. The Nintendo Switch version of the popular title is coming out very soon -- this month, in fact, on May 17, just announced by publisher Versus Evil and developer Stoic Studio.

The Banner Saga first debuted on PC four years ago back in January 2014, and then it made its way to PlayStation 4 and Xbox One in January 2016. Now it's settling down on Switch, where you can play through an epic RPG where you travel with your caravan across the landscape and fight off threats that could end up putting your entire civilization in danger. It's also drawn ridiculously well.

You can choose from over 25 playable characters as you bring your adventure to life, accompanied by music from Grammy-nominated composed Austin Wintory and 2D artwork that looks like it should be part of its own special film.

Like what you see? You'll be happy to know this is the first part of a trilogy for Switch, so your journey won't have to come to an end for quite some time.
